20 Nov 2009, 5:57 pm by Brendon Tavelli
 The agencies’ efforts in this regard were spurned by the Financial Services Regulatory Relief Act of 2006, which amended the Gramm-Leach-Bliley Act (“GLBA”) and called upon the federal financial services agencies to jointly propose a succinct and comprehensible format for GLBA privacy notices.The final model privacy notice form was developed jointly by the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ve System, Commodity Futures Trading Commission, Federal Deposit… [read post]
